Itinerary
Take a break from the city for an adventurous day of hiking set among the beautiful outdoor scenery outside Bogotá on this visit to two of the country’s most impressive waterfalls.
Begin your day with pickup from your hotel in Bogotá and drive to the East Hills, a series of rolling forest-covered peaks set among the Andes mountain range. As your transportation heads ever higher into the mountains, listen as your guide shares details of the area’s geology, and check out the breathtaking views from the roadside cliffs and chasms below.
Start your hike through the area’s bright green forests, heading toward your first stop, the waterfall of El Chiflón. Once you arrive at this pounding torrent of water, feel climb behind the falls for a unique view, or jump into the inviting turquoise waters below to cool off. Please Note: The authorities of the Park need to authorize our visit so the decision depends on them.
Your guide will provide a local snack to help you refuel before moving on to the next waterfall.
Head back into the forests for a strenuous hike to the towering La Chorrera waterfall. The route up to this stunning site offers an opportunity to observe the region’s diverse plant life, including bromeliads, juniper, orchids, sapodilla, cedar, and mahogany. Soon you’ll hear the roar of this natural wonder in the distance. Arrive at this 1,936-foot (590m) tall waterfall, taking a moment to get a few pictures and cool off before beginning the return hike.
Finish your day back in La Candelaria or via Choachi, with a traditional Colombian lunch and time for some quick sightseeing. Finish your day with a return trip back to your Bogotá hotel.
Please note: this tour involves traveling and hiking at altitudes ranging from 6,309 to 8,530 feet (1,923 to 2,600m) above sea level.

Rajeev_M, Dec 2022
We had a wonderful time! The tour was a little pricey, but worth every penny as it was just us and the guide. For most of the hike, we didn't see any other people, and our guide was constantly telling us about different plants, animals, and people who live in the area. The waterfalls were gorgeous though the water flow was a little less than normal because it was dry season. The hiking is no joke, it's around 5.6 miles and plenty of slippery gravel and elevation change, so definitely wear hiking boots! Also, lunch was fantastic at a local restaurant!

Ognjenka_O, Dec 2021
We really had a great time hiking to La Chorrera and we are glad that we booked our tour. Our guide Andreas was really cool and easy going, he was knowledgeable and and provided many useful info.
The trail itself is quite demanding and it can be very hard at certain points due to slippery rocks and tree roots, steep ascents and descents. I would not recommend to anyone who has walking problems or any other health issues.
The nature and landscape is amazing. There are so many points for great pictures. The waterfall was unique and we were lucky there was enough water coming down. Sometimes when it does not rain for sometime, you can see only few drops and it will be disappointing. It is always important to check before the departure what conditions to expect.
Overall it was an amazing experience and we really enjoyed it.
